This isn't corned beef but it is wonderful. Simmer a beef brisket in salted water with a couple cut up onions till you are able to put a fork through the meat. Take it out and drain (save the water for soup base, if you'd like). Brush or roll the brisket in your favorite barbeque sauce and place in a roasting pan, roast at 325, continue brushing with barbeque sauce while it is cooking, roast until the meat it is very tender. (tip: line the roasting pan with tin foil for easy clean up). You can slice it or tear it apart for barbequed beef sandwiches. In the summer I cover it with the sauce, wrap it in foil and put it on the grill in a spot where it won't burn and leave it for a couple of hours.
